Wärtsilä Corporation, Press release, 11 May 2017 at 10 am EET

The technology group Wärtsilä is to supply the main engines for a new and
innovative expedition mega yacht, owned by Genting Hong Kong which also owns the
MV WERFTEN yards in Germany where the vessel is to be built. There is an option
for an additional two vessels in this "Endeavor" class series. The order with
Wärtsilä was booked in March 2017.

The new vessel will be the world's largest expedition mega yacht with ice class
certification, and will be able to operate in polar region waters. Passenger
comfort and operational reliability were cited as being major considerations for
the equipment selected. Four 6-cylinder Wärtsilä 32 engines combined with
Wärtsilä NOx Reducer (NOR) systems will provide the electrical power for the
ship. The system is fully compliant with the IMO Tier III exhaust emission
regulations set out in Annex VI of the MARPOL 73/78 convention. The equipment is
scheduled to be delivered to the yard in 2018.

Wärtsilä had earlier delivered more than 30 Wärtsilä 32 engines for eight
vessels built by these yards and the company has also delivered the majority of
the 4-stroke engines, both main and auxiliary engines, installed by the yard




during the past ten years.

The Wärtsilä 32 engine is based on the latest achievements in combustion
technology, and is designed for efficient and easy maintenance with long
maintenance-free operating periods. The engine is fully equipped with all
essential ancillaries and a thoroughly planned interface to external systems.
The Wärtsilä 32 engine, in conjunction with the Wärtsilä NOR system, is fully
compliant with the IMO Tier III exhaust emission regulations set out in Annex VI
of the MARPOL 73/78 convention.

About Genting Hong Kong Limited ("Genting Hong Kong")
Genting Hong Kong is a leading corporation principally engaged in the business
of cruise and cruise related operations along with leisure, entertainment and
hospitality activities.
As a pioneer in the Asian cruise industry, Genting Hong Kong took on the bold
initiative to grow the Asia-Pacific as an international cruise destination with
the founding of Star Cruises, "The Most Popular Cruise Line in Asia", in 1993.
In 2015, to further expand its cruise portfolio in the region, Genting Hong Kong
launched Dream Cruises, "Asia's Luxury Cruise Line" to cater to the Asian luxury
market. The same year, Genting finalized the acquisition of Crystal Cruises,
recognized as "The World's Most Awarded Luxury Cruise Line" to extend Genting
Hong Kong's reach in the global up-scale market. Genting bought three shipyards
in Germany in 2016, collectively known as "MV Werften", to build cruise ships up
to 200,000 gross tons for its three cruise brands, following the purchase of
Lloyd Werft the previous year which specializes in building Megayachts and other
newbuilds.
